Title
• The title summarizes the main idea or ideas of
your study.
• A good title contains the fewest possible words
that adequately describe the contents and/or
purpose of your research paper.
• The title is without doubt the part of a paper that
is read the most, and it is usually read first.
• It should be clear.
• It should be according to your area of research.
• It should be consisted on both depended and
independent variables.

Problem Statement
Answer the question: “What is the gap that
needs to be filled?” and/or “What is the
problem that needs to be solved?”
State the problem clearly early in a
paragraph.
Limit the variables you address in stating
your problem or question.
Consider framing the problem as a
question.

Research Objectives
Objectives are statements of what you intend to
do to find the answer to your research question/s
through your methodology.
Explain the goals and research objectives of the
study.
Show the original contributions of your study.
Include a rationale for the study.
Be clear about what your study will not
address.
Objectives should be
The stated objectives should be SMART
Specific,
Measurable,
Assignable,
Realistic and
Time-related

Review of Literature
• The Literature Review provides the
background for the research problem and
illustrates to the reader that the researcher
is knowledgeable about the scope of the
theory.
• Research as many studies pertaining to the
theory as possible, and summarize them in
a succinct manner.
Methodology
Introduce the overall methodological approach.
Indicate how the approach fits the overall
research design.
Describe the specific methods of data collection.
Explain how you intend to analyze and interpret
your results (e.g. statistical analysis)
If necessary, provide background and rationale
for unfamiliar methodologies.
